Howard County approves $47,993 one-time fiber upgrade to boost bandwidth at west-side buildings
Howard County Commissioners · November 18, 2025

Information Services requested and the board authorized a one-time $47,993 fiber optic upgrade to upgrade several 1-gig links to 10-gig across west-side county buildings to support IP phones, cameras and other networked services.
